J.P. Morgan takes a solution-based approach to custody, helping clients maximize processing efficiency within a robust, controlled, automated and information-rich environment. With offices in each region of the world and a network of sub custodians covering more than 90 markets, we help clients meet the challenges of cross-border investing and actively promote global standards for efficiency and risk management.
The CFS Middle Office Department is responsible for ensuring all aspects of operations for Global Custody clients are completed on time, exceptions are resolved, and client inquiries are resolved and provide subject matter expertise to the clients. This would be a cross product client facing role that requires extensive client interaction & communication and working with various global internal teams as required. The candidate will be expected to hone and utilize their communication skills to effectively work through tasks of varying difficulty with external and internal stakeholders.
Key responsibilities
· Working directly with Custody Clients on a daily basis to assist in the execution and implementation of new business and incremental business wins, exiting funds and fund restructures.
· Oversight and controls for Conversion Associate planning and preparation for a Transition event, including: agreeing transition strategy, performing in depth portfolio analysis, account structure and static data checks, delivery of accurate SSI's, executing stock movements in to, out of and between accounts, plus monitoring market trading, ensuring timely settlement of trades.
· Managing and coordinating event scheduling and planning with external asset managers and custodians as well as all impacted internal parties
· Check and sign off initial portfolio analysis.
· Identifying problem assets, positions in liquidation etc. prior to transition
· Work with Network and CI on all account opening requirements
· Manage the correct collation of risk and credit profiles on exits
· Adhere to controls and procedures, attest to team SOPs, ensuring all key risk and quality indicators are met and MIS is accurate and completed timely
· Resolution, cash and stock break management
· Dealing directly with customers to ensure continuous high level service is achieved
· Attend conference calls & meetings across multiple locations and product areas to ensure plans are developed and actions completed on target.
· Ensure team controls are adhered to, involvement in Business resiliency planning, Audit & Risk reviews and client/counterparty site visits.
